KRISTINA KRUSE, MD

KRISTINA KRUSE, MD

Overview

Born and raised in rural Ohio.

Graduated with her Bachelor of Science in 2013 from The Ohio State University with a major in Biology. Attended Ross University School of Medicine and completed her medical doctorate in 2018.

Completed residency in family medicine in 2021 at the Medical College of Georgia Department of Family Medicine at Augusta University Medical Center.

Dr. Kruse’s research presentations include research in thyroidectomies, chronic pain management, and addiction medicine.

Certifications include lactation consultation, osteopathic manipulation, medical ultrasound, geriatrics, and medication assisted therapy in addiction medicine.

In her free time, she enjoys outdoor activities with her family and traveling.

Accepting patients of all types into her practice, including:
  • newborns
  • Pediatrics
  • Adolescents
  • Women’s health
  • Adults
  • Geriatrics
